Ports","doi":"10.1109/PICMET.2003.1222820","DOIUrl":"https://doi.org/10.1109/PICMET.2003.1222820","url":null,"abstract":"High tech marketing is characterized by high levels of technical, market and financial uncertainties, rapidly declining prices, collapsing markets and shortening product life cycles. Conventional strategic analysis tools are inadequate for effective analysis in developing high tech marketing strategy. This paper reviews a portfolio of contemporary strategic analysis tools that have been used effectively in developing high tech marketing strategies and case analyses. These include the Boston Consulting Group's (BCG) portfolio matrix, the technology adoption life cycle, the whole product concept, and disruptive technologies mapping. Some of these tools have been effective in alleviating the engineering - marketing interface issues in high tech companies. Niwa","doi":"10.1109/PICMET.2003.1222780","DOIUrl":"https://doi.org/10.1109/PICMET.2003.1222780","url":null,"abstract":"In Japan the S&T basic law was enacted in 1995, and two S&T basic plans based on the law have already been in operation. These basic plans have become gradually improved. However, it seems to be insufficient yet from the viewpoint of target systematization. There is a fact behind this that methodologies by which we can form scientifically S&T policy in order to prove it possible. The participants in the experiment were members of the Committee on Technology Policy (CTP) of the Engineering Academy of Japan (EAJ), and the number of regular participants was nearly 10. The period of the experiment was about two and a half years. The period of the experiment was about two and a half years, from the mid-year of 1997 to the beginning of 1999. The method mainly used was discussion, but frequently we adopted several so-called soft technologies, such as IMS (Interpretative Structural Modeling), pair comparison, cluster analysis and so on. Finally, we obtained a system of S&T policy targets. The system obtained is composed of five layers, namely, major targets, medium targets, minor targets, examples of measures and sets of science, engineering, and technology (SETs) that contribute to measures. Omar","doi":"10.1109/PICMET.2003.1222806","DOIUrl":"https://doi.org/10.1109/PICMET.2003.1222806","url":null,"abstract":"Successful technology management in the contemporary business environment requires the ability to rapidly translate new ideas into viable commercial products that serve the needs of the market place. Delays experienced during the development of new products only impede the rate of progress that is so critical to the success of the technology-intensive firm. This study identifies the most common causes of schedule delays based on a detailed examination of 451 delays experienced in 22 major weapon system development programs. This study employs a life cycle framework to examine delays associated with the stages of the new product development process. Technical difficulties experienced in the performance of key stage activities were the most often cited category of delays. Changes to the design were also a frequently reported cause of delay and information, as well as parts, material, equipment and tooling are also prominent reasons for delay. Weber","doi":"10.1109/PICMET.2003.1222802","DOIUrl":"https://doi.org/10.1109/PICMET.2003.1222802","url":null,"abstract":"A numerical model that identifies the high-leverage variables associated with profitability in high technology manufacturing is presented. Varying the parameters of the model demonstrates that a rapid yield-learning rate determines profitability more than any other factor does. Factors such as ramping up to production early, adding factory capacity, maximizing quality, and increasing the robustness of product designs all yield diminishing returns. Ewton","doi":"10.1109/PICMET.2003.1222795","DOIUrl":"https://doi.org/10.1109/PICMET.2003.1222795","url":null,"abstract":"The Internet has dramatically changed our lives and the way we do business. With the innovation of e-commerce companies can reach customers and sell products almost instantaneously. As an outcome, e-commerce has grown tremendously and the rapid changes taking place in information technology in conjunction with the dynamic nature of the market provide rich opportunities for research. This research assesses emerging e-commerce technologies and the impact of these technologies on overall business processes. The methodology utilized is an analytic Delphi study where experts assessed the adoption of e-commerce technologies and the impacts of these technologies on overall business processes. Delphi offered a mechanism to make these assessments via a panel and was the chosen methodology because the Internet is a relatively new technology and thus, sufficient historical data were not available to effectively utilize other traditional forecasting methodologies. Once the initial e-commerce technologies were identified via traditional Delphi, the analytic hierarchy process was used to quantify expert's judgments. The research methodology required a team of twelve e-commerce experts to respond to three sets of research instruments.
